Bank of Nova Scotia (BNS) Stock Moves -0.56%: What You Should Know

This story originally appeared on Zacks

Bank of Nova Scotia (BNS) closed at $71.42 in the latest trading session, marking a -0.56% move from the prior day. This move was narrower than the S&P 500’s daily loss of 1.84%. Meanwhile, the Dow lost 1.38%, and the Nasdaq, a tech-heavy index, lost 0.38%.

Heading into today, shares of the bank had gained 1.2% over the past month, outpacing the Finance sector’s gain of 0.4% and the S&P 500’s loss of 1.96% in that time.

Wall Street will be looking for positivity from Bank of Nova Scotia as it approaches its next earnings report date. This is expected to be March 1, 2022. In that report, analysts expect Bank of Nova Scotia to post earnings of $1.65 per share. This would mark year-over-year growth of 13.01%. Our most recent consensus estimate is calling for quarterly revenue of $6.21 billion, down 0.94% from the year-ago period.

For the full year, our Zacks Consensus Estimates are projecting earnings of $6.62 per share and revenue of $25.42 billion, which would represent changes of +5.92% and +2.48%, respectively, from the prior year.

The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has moved 0.2% lower within the past month. Bank of Nova Scotia is currently sporting a Zacks Rank of #4 (Sell).

Digging into valuation, Bank of Nova Scotia currently has a Forward P/E ratio of 10.86. Its industry sports an average Forward P/E of 10.34, so we one might conclude that Bank of Nova Scotia is trading at a premium comparatively.

We can also see that BNS currently has a PEG ratio of 1.01. This metric is used similarly to the famous P/E ratio, but the PEG ratio also takes into account the stock’s expected earnings growth rate. BNS’s industry had an average PEG ratio of 0.79 as of yesterday’s close.

The Banks – Foreign industry is part of the Finance sector. This industry currently has a Zacks Industry Rank of 75, which puts it in the top 30% of all 250+ industries.
